Woman cries out over surgery error, appeals for assistance to offset N2. 3 million medical bill

Lokoja – Miss Faith Sunday, a 30-year old lady from Okene , Kogi state has appealed to good spirited individuals and corporate organisations to come to her aid by offsetting her N2 .3 million medical bill.

The lady who has been bedridden in the last six months said the N2 .3 million was the cost of drugs and her treatment at Shifaah Hospital , a private hospital in Lokoja.

According to the lady, her ordeal started in a private hospital in Lagos where she went through a surgical operation to remove fibroid.

She said that her health condition took a new turn when her intestine was tampered with during the operation.

“Six days after the failed operation , I started developing complications and the hospital referred me to another hospital where I was asked to deposit N1.5 million for another operation,” She explained.

However, Sunday, said that she could not raise the money and had to return home where she started living in pains for days.

She said that the pains were so severe that her mother had to run down to Lagos to come and bring her to Shifaah Hospital, Lokoja.

One of the doctors at Shifaah Hospital , Dr Muazu Musa said Faith was unconscious when she was brought to the hospital 72 days ago.

He said that they were able to stabilise her and thereafter performed exploratory laparotomy (resection and anastomosis) on her to correct the error inflicted on her in Lagos hospital.

“The operation lasted for eight hours and it took another 24 hours before she regained consciousness.

“We have been managing her condition in the last 72 days in this hospital and while we are doing that , her mother who went to Lagos to bring her to this hospital fell sick and died.

“The late mother used to be her major financier as her father is a retiree.

“We thank Almighty God that she has recovered fully but the major challenge we have now is how she can offset her hospital bills which had accumulated to N2. 3 million,” the doctor explained.

Musa said the lady is fit now and ought to have been discharged two weeks ago but her inability to pay her accumulated medical bill would not allow for that.

“The bill is still running because she is still within the hospital facility,” he said.
